A Composite Scottish Basket-Hilted Backsword
Last Quarter Of The 17th Century

With tapering blade double-edged towards the point and with narrow fuller along the back on each side, the forte incised with various marks including a cross on both sides, iron ribbon guard of broad partly line engraved flat bars (some damage and repairs) forming irregular openings involving a circular panel on each side, flat disc-shaped pommel with button, and later spirally-grooved leather-covered grip (pitted overall)
85.2 cm. blade
